Park for free at the Frostburg Depot, check in inside at 9:30 and head down the mountain! Coast at your own pace down the mountain all the way to Cumberland.
This is an easy 19 mile ride most anyone can do. The first 15 miles are all downhill at a constant 1.75% downhill slope. After Lunch in Cumberland the last 4 miles along the C&O Towpath to the boat launch is a flat level trail.
Once you reach Canal Place Cumberland Station, feel free to check out the sites and grab lunch on your own. We suggest the Crabby Pig, Queen City Creamery, Baltimore Street Grille and Dig Deep Brewery if you would like to just grab a brew. They are all within a few minutes walk.
Head into C&O Canal National Park and enjoy a beautiful remnant of early transportation history. You will be biking on the lifeline of the communities along the Potomac River and a section of the most beautiful portions of trail from Canal Place in Cumberland to the boat launch is approximately 3.75 miles.
